At this moment, the entire competition grounds were buzzing with heated discussions. The students of Tianjing Academy were extremely enthusiastic, a stark contrast to the cold and cheerless atmosphere from yesterday. Not only was the small competition grounds filled to the brim with thousands of people, there were even a large number of Tianjing Academy students gathered outside the competition grounds, watching the live broadcast on the large screens outside. Whether it was those who were hoping for a miracle, those who were purely here to watch the show, or those who were purely here to cheer for the academy's team, all of them filled up the entire stadium.
In this day and age, face was the most important thing!
Even if we lose, we have to lose in a dignified manner. We can't let others look down on us. This is our home ground!
Tianjing Academy Media's Reporter Little Mei was currently standing at the side of the competition grounds. With one hand pressed against her earbuds and the other holding onto a microphone, she was currently shouting at the top of her lungs in front of the camera. "I'm too touched by the passion displayed by the students today! Even if I'm plugged in my ears, I can still hear the tsunami-like cheers! Despite the fact that their opponent was Adolf Academy, who was second only to Copperfield in last year's regionals, none of the students from Tianjing Academy had any fear towards them! We still have a chance! We have Student Grai, who is known to be the MVP of this year's newcomers. We also have the genius girl, captain Scarlet … I'm sorry, but just now, the official members of both squadrons have been announced. The captain of our Tianjing Academy squadron has been officially changed to Senior Wang Zhong! "
"Ah?" The sudden decision to change the leader made the students in the stands a little confused.
"What the hell? Isn't Scarlet the captain?"
"Wang Zhong? That Wang Zhong from the second-year command department? "
"I've heard that it seems to be an internal decision by the squadron. Scarlet has given Wang Zhong the captain!"
When Reeves had left the academy, there had been a dispute over who should be the captain of the squadron. From the point of view of qualifications, Lily was the most suitable candidate. She was a heavy soldier who would charge at the front, and would be able to easily lead the momentum of the squadron. Furthermore, she was a senior sister of a third year. There was no need to say anything about her strength and character, as well as her experience in last year's competition. In the end, Grace appointed Scarlet. Although she was still a little immature, everyone was able to accept the fact that she was the president of Black Rose, the headmaster's granddaughter, and the academy's goddess.
But who the hell was Wang Zhong? Don't brag about your performance during the training. It's true that you didn't pass the final exam last year, right? You didn't fake it, did you? You've been at the bottom of the pack for a year, haven't you? Even if he were to mingle in the Prodigy Society, he would only have the title of 'Vice President'. Even if they were to compete in looks, he wouldn't have a chance.
In terms of strength, experience, status, and looks, you don't have an advantage in any of these, yet you want to be the team leader? Could it be that the recent rumors were true, that Scarlet and Wang Zhong …
At the thought of this, 80% of the boys in the school felt like they had been f * cked. And it was a male.
Although there had been rumors circulating in the past, no one had really taken them seriously. But now, they had already made an official announcement … More importantly, they were facing a formidable enemy. Whoever dared to speak up at this time would be making an enemy of the entire squadron, or even the entire academy.
"I've heard that Wang Zhong's theory subjects are pretty good. I'm guessing that he's in charge of formulating strategies."
"The captain's main role is still to deploy troops and arrange battle tactics. I remember Wang Zhong's article 'On Gefso's Teamwork Art' was published in the school newspaper last year. It was pretty well written."
"Last year's number one in theory and the command department's top student. With him arranging battle tactics, who knows, he might have some strange moves. Furthermore, he might even be able to act as a smokescreen. Who knows, Wang Zhong might even be able to deal with Cecil. That's definitely the case!"
They could only sigh at the powerful imagination of humans. Soon, the Tianjing students suddenly felt that it wasn't a loss.
"The members of both sides have already entered the arena. The captains of both sides are currently handing over the name lists for the first match!" Reporter Little Mei loudly introduced. "In the group competition, a good start is extremely important! That's because the winning side has the opportunity to be sent out later in the next match. That way, they can make targeted adjustments based on the occupation and strength of their opponent's members! Many strong squadrons have swept their opponents 4-0 by relying on winning the first match. Then, they would be able to take the lead step by step! "
The contest between two squadrons wasn't just about who was fiercer and who was stronger. The captain's arrangement of troops was also extremely important.
According to the regular competition system, there would generally be six matches. The five individual matches would each be worth one point, and the final match would be a five-on-five group battle, which would be worth two points.
Under such a competition system, unless all five of them were super peak experts and could directly suppress their opponents, there were far too many stories of the weak defeating the strong by relying on tactics, strategies, and various other methods. Sometimes, using one's brain was better than using one's martial strength. Thinking back to Wang Zhong's theoretical results in the command department last year, many people were doubtful, but they still had some expectations.
Very quickly, the name list for the first match was released. The eyes of all the students in the arena fiercely twitched.
Tianjing Academy's Lily!
As the number one female heavy soldier of Tianjing Academy, there was nothing wrong with her being the first to go up. In fact, before the name list was released, the majority of the students felt that Lily should be the first to go up.
After Reeves left, other than the newly promoted Grai, Lily remained the second strongest expert within the squadron in the hearts of the ordinary students. She was slightly stronger than the other third year students, Colby and Milami. Furthermore, she was a heavy soldier that was more inclined towards the offensive type. She had an outstanding performance in both offense and defense, making her an extremely reliable duel partner.
However, her opponent … just had to be Adolf's vice-captain, Simon. His weapon of choice was a cannon. Heavy firearms had always been the nemesis of heavy soldiers.
This was a counter! This was definitely a counter!
Adolf's captain had already guessed who would be sent up. Originally, Tianjing's strength was slightly weaker. Now that they were being countered in such a manner, it was obvious that they were completely crushed in both strength and intelligence.
They had to kneel!
If the captain was Scarlet, then it might have been fine. After all, she was the captain that everyone had acknowledged. Furthermore, she was also a beauty. What's more, letting a heavy soldier be the first to test the waters. Although it was mediocre, there wasn't much to nitpick about. Other than bemoaning their bad luck, there didn't seem to be anything else that could be said.
However, the problem was, who was the captain of this squadron?
The captain was Wang Zhong! He was an outstanding theoretical student of the command department, the number one student in last year's examinations, and the light of hope of the academy who had jumped three ranks to become the captain!
Since you've become the light of hope of the academy, and have been promoted as an exception, then you should have appeared in a radiant and glorious manner. You should have used your feather fan and silk handkerchief to devise strategies. You should have pointed out the country's mountains and stirred up the literary world. You should have used the tactics of Tian Ji's horse race to perfection. You should have toyed with your opponent in the palm of your hand. You should have laughed and laughed as you watched your opponent turn into ashes!
In the end, you were the one who had put up such a formal battle formation. However, you had been caught off guard the moment you appeared. Instead, you had been completely crushed by your opponent.
What happened to being an outstanding student? What happened to your intelligence? What happened to being the light of hope? You shouldn't have!
